IT培訓(xùn)網(wǎng)
IT在線學(xué)習(xí)
隨著互聯(lián)網(wǎng)的飛速發(fā)展,前端開發(fā)作為互聯(lián)網(wǎng)行業(yè)的“門面擔(dān)當(dāng)”,越來(lái)越受到人們的關(guān)注。許多人紛紛轉(zhuǎn)行或?qū)W習(xí)前端開發(fā),那么,學(xué)好前端開發(fā)需要多長(zhǎng)時(shí)間呢?
前端開發(fā)是指利用HTML、CSS和JavaScript等前端技術(shù),構(gòu)建用戶界面和處理用戶交互的一種開發(fā)方式。在互聯(lián)網(wǎng)時(shí)代,前端開發(fā)者為打造用戶友好界面的核心力量,無(wú)疑成為了互聯(lián)網(wǎng)行業(yè)中不可或缺的角色之一。從網(wǎng)頁(yè)設(shè)計(jì)到交互邏輯,再到響應(yīng)式布局,前端開發(fā)者都要掌握。
一、了解前端開發(fā)基礎(chǔ)知識(shí)(預(yù)計(jì)學(xué)習(xí)時(shí)間:1-3個(gè)月)
前端開發(fā)的基礎(chǔ)知識(shí)包括HTML、CSS和JavaScript等。。HTML是網(wǎng)頁(yè)的基礎(chǔ)結(jié)構(gòu),CSS負(fù)責(zé)網(wǎng)頁(yè)的樣式,而JavaScript則用于實(shí)現(xiàn)網(wǎng)頁(yè)的交互功能。同時(shí),還需要掌握相關(guān)的開發(fā)工具,如Visual Studio Code等。這些框架和庫(kù)可以幫助開發(fā)者更快速地構(gòu)建優(yōu)美的界面和實(shí)現(xiàn)復(fù)雜的功能。
二、選擇適合自己的學(xué)習(xí)方式(預(yù)計(jì)學(xué)習(xí)時(shí)間:不限)
學(xué)習(xí)前端開發(fā)有多種方式,其中最常見的方式是自學(xué)和參加在線課程。對(duì)于零基礎(chǔ)的初學(xué)者來(lái)說(shuō),建議先從在線課程入手,因?yàn)檫@些課程通常都是由經(jīng)驗(yàn)豐富的老師授課,能夠引導(dǎo)你正確的學(xué)習(xí)方向,同時(shí)還能幫助你理解一些難以理解的概念。
三、制定學(xué)習(xí)計(jì)劃(預(yù)計(jì)學(xué)習(xí)時(shí)間:1-3個(gè)月)
制定學(xué)習(xí)計(jì)劃可以幫助學(xué)習(xí)者明確學(xué)習(xí)目標(biāo)和進(jìn)度,合理分配時(shí)間,掌握學(xué)習(xí)重點(diǎn)和難點(diǎn)。如果是零基礎(chǔ),建議可以找一些專業(yè)的指導(dǎo)課程,協(xié)助自己梳理知識(shí)脈絡(luò),制定學(xué)習(xí)路線。
當(dāng)你有了一定的基礎(chǔ)之后,可以嘗試通過(guò)閱讀書籍、查閱文檔和參與開源項(xiàng)目等方式來(lái)提高自己的技能水平。前端開發(fā)領(lǐng)域涉及眾多技術(shù),例如React、Vue、Angular等,這些技術(shù)可以幫助您實(shí)現(xiàn)更復(fù)雜的前端應(yīng)用。
四、實(shí)踐是提高技能的關(guān)鍵(預(yù)計(jì)學(xué)習(xí)時(shí)間:3-5個(gè)月)
學(xué)習(xí)前端開發(fā)不僅僅是掌握理論知識(shí),更重要的是實(shí)踐。你可以通過(guò)制作自己的個(gè)人網(wǎng)站、參與開源項(xiàng)目或?yàn)榕笥鸦蚣胰碎_發(fā)一些小項(xiàng)目來(lái)鍛煉自己的實(shí)踐能力。在這些實(shí)踐中,你需要注重代碼的可讀性、可維護(hù)性和可擴(kuò)展性等方面,不斷提高自己的編碼水平。
五、關(guān)注前端發(fā)展趨勢(shì)(預(yù)計(jì)學(xué)習(xí)時(shí)間:長(zhǎng)期)
前端開發(fā)領(lǐng)域是一個(gè)不斷發(fā)展的領(lǐng)域,因此你需要時(shí)刻關(guān)注前端發(fā)展趨勢(shì),了解最新的前端技術(shù)和工具。例如,近年來(lái)前端框架不斷涌現(xiàn),如React、Vue和Angular等,這些框架能夠幫助你更高效地開發(fā)Web應(yīng)用程序。同時(shí),還需要關(guān)注前端與后端、移動(dòng)端等其他領(lǐng)域的交互技術(shù),如RESTful API和GraphQL等。
六、加入社區(qū),與其他開發(fā)者交流(預(yù)計(jì)學(xué)習(xí)時(shí)間:長(zhǎng)期)
加入前端開發(fā)者社區(qū)是一個(gè)很好的學(xué)習(xí)方式。你可以通過(guò)社區(qū)與其他開發(fā)者交流經(jīng)驗(yàn)、分享心得和討論問(wèn)題。這不僅能提高你的社交能力,還能讓你不斷學(xué)習(xí)到新的知識(shí)和技能。同時(shí),社區(qū)還可以為你提供一些有用的資源和工具,如代碼庫(kù)、測(cè)試工具和自動(dòng)化部署工具等。
七、持續(xù)學(xué)習(xí)和更新知識(shí)(預(yù)計(jì)學(xué)習(xí)時(shí)間:長(zhǎng)期)
初學(xué)者需要掌握基礎(chǔ)知識(shí)、常用框架和工具,學(xué)習(xí)前端框架和庫(kù),并培養(yǎng)良好的編程習(xí)慣和學(xué)習(xí)能力。技術(shù)日新月異,前端開發(fā)者需要保持敏銳的洞察力和學(xué)習(xí)能力,跟進(jìn)技術(shù)動(dòng)態(tài),擁抱變化。
八、總結(jié)
前端學(xué)習(xí)時(shí)間因人而異,根據(jù)學(xué)習(xí)內(nèi)容和個(gè)人理解能力時(shí)間不同。一般來(lái)說(shuō),從零基礎(chǔ)到初級(jí)前端開發(fā)者,大約需要5個(gè)月到1年的時(shí)間。若每天保持2-3小時(shí)的學(xué)習(xí)時(shí)間,并持續(xù)進(jìn)行學(xué)習(xí),一般可以在1年內(nèi)達(dá)到中高級(jí)水平。當(dāng)然,如果你天賦異稟或者有編程基礎(chǔ),時(shí)間可能會(huì)更短。
總的來(lái)說(shuō),前端開發(fā)的學(xué)習(xí)之旅是一場(chǎng)馬拉松,而非短跑,從零基礎(chǔ)開始學(xué)好前端開發(fā)需要一定時(shí)間和精力。要成為優(yōu)秀的前端開發(fā)者,需要不斷堅(jiān)持和努力。只有通過(guò)不斷地學(xué)習(xí)和實(shí)踐,您才能逐步解鎖前端開發(fā)的奧秘,成為一名優(yōu)秀的前端開發(fā)人員。如果大家對(duì)Web前端開發(fā)感興趣想要了解更多前端開發(fā)內(nèi)容的請(qǐng)持續(xù)關(guān)注優(yōu)就業(yè)Web前端培訓(xùn)官網(wǎng)。
更多內(nèi)容
>>本文地址:http://www.yiyunku.cn/jiaoxue/2023/73183.html
聲明:本站稿件版權(quán)均屬中公教育優(yōu)就業(yè)所有,未經(jīng)許可不得擅自轉(zhuǎn)載。
1 您的年齡
2 您的學(xué)歷
3 您更想做哪個(gè)方向的工作?